Splatoon 1 & 2 Weapons Confirmed For Splatoon 3; Splattershot Jr. Mains Rejoice

This morning, the official Twitter account of Nintendo of Europe confirmed that all basic weapons from Splatoon 1 and Splatoon 2 will be returning in Splatoon 3. The tweet’s image shows various weapons from those games, such as the Squelcher, the N-ZAP ’85, the Splattershot Pro, among others. Whether their status or their special weapon kits will be retained however, is unknown.

Furthermore, the official Splatoon Twitter account has showcased a thread containing various weapons that are confirmed for the game, with the Splattershot, Splattershot Jr., and the .96 Gal currently confirmed, but with more weapons down the line.

Splatoon 3 is the brand-new sequel to Splatoon 2. In this new game in the Splatoon series, you’ll leave Inkopolis behind and head to a new region: the Splatlands. Its heart is a new city where battle-savvy Inklings and Octolings gather: Splatsville, also known as the “City of Chaos.”

In addition, Splatoon 3 introduces various features to the action-shooter series, including weapons such as the bow-weapon, customization options, and movement abilities to bring to the returning 4v4 Turf Wars matches. Splatoon 3 will release exclusively on Nintendo Switch on September 9.
